📄 core.html.fr
字号:
chacun de ces répertoires. Par exemple:</p> <blockquote> <code>AccessFileName .acl</code> </blockquote> <p>Avant de servir le document <code>/usr/local/web/index.html</code>, le serveur lira les fichiers <code>/.acl</code>, <code>/usr/.acl</code>, <code>/usr/local/.acl</code> et <code>/usr/local/web/.acl</code> à la recherche de directives, sauf si celles-ci ont été désactivées par l'écriture</p> <blockquote> <code><Directory /> AllowOverride None </Directory></code> </blockquote> <p><strong>Voir également :</strong> <a href="#allowoverride">AllowOverride</a></p> <hr /> <h2><a id="adddefaultcharset" name="adddefaultcharset">Directive AddDefaultCharset</a></h2> <a href="directive-dict.html#Syntax" rel="Help"><strong>Syntaxe :</strong></a> AddDefaultCharset On|Off|<em>charset</em><br /> <a href="directive-dict.html#Context" rel="Help"><strong>Contexte :</strong></a> tous<br /> <a href="directive-dict.html#Status" rel="Help"><strong>Statut :</strong></a> noyau<br /> <a href="directive-dict.html#Default" rel="Help"><strong>Défaut :</strong></a> <code>AddDefaultCharset Off</code><br /> <a href="directive-dict.html#Compatibility" rel="Help"><strong>Compatibilité :</strong></a> AddDefaultCharset n'est disponible qu'à partir de la version 1.3.12 <p>Cette directive spécifie le nom de la table de caractères qui sera ajouté à toutes les réponses qui n'ont aucun paramètre sur le type de contenu dans l'en-tête HTTP. Elle remplace la table de caractère spécifié dans le corps du document par l'utilisation du marqueur <code>META</code>. La mise de <code>AddDefaultCharset Off</code> désactive cette fonctionnalité. <code>AddDefaultCharset On</code> active la table de caractère <code>iso-8859-1</code> par défaut d'Apache. Vous pouvez également définir une autre table de caractères à employer. Par exemple <code>AddDefaultCharset utf-8</code>.</p> <hr /> <h2><a id="addmodule" name="addmodule">Directive AddModule</a></h2> <!--%plaintext <?INDEX {\tt AddModule} directive> --> <a href="directive-dict.html#Syntax" rel="Help"><strong>Syntaxe :</strong></a> AddModule <em>module</em> [<em>module</em>] ...<br /> <a href="directive-dict.html#Context" rel="Help"><strong>Contexte :</strong></a> configuration serveur <br /> <a href="directive-dict.html#Status" rel="Help"><strong>Statut :</strong></a> noyau<br /> <a href="directive-dict.html#Compatibility" rel="Help"><strong>Compatibilité :</strong></a> <tt>AddModule</tt> n'est disponible qu'à partir de la version 1.2 d'Apache <p>Le serveur peut intégrer des modules compilés qui ne sont pas mis en service. Cette directive peut être utilisée pour activer ou désactiver ces modules. Le serveur est installé avec une liste pré-configurée de modules actifs cette liste peut être effacée par la directive <a href="#clearmodulelist">ClearModuleList</a>.</p> <hr /> <h2><a id="allowoverride" name="allowoverride">Directive AllowOverride</a></h2> <!--%plaintext <?INDEX {\tt AllowOverride} directive> --> <a href="directive-dict.html#Syntax" rel="Help"><strong>Syntaxe :</strong></a> AllowOverride All|None|<em>type de directive</em> [<em>type de directive</em>] ... <br /> <a href="directive-dict.html#Default" rel="Help"><strong>Défaut :</strong></a> <code>AllowOverride All All</code><br /> <a href="directive-dict.html#Context" rel="Help"><strong>Contexte :</strong></a> répertoire<br /> <a href="directive-dict.html#Status" rel="Help"><strong>Statut :</strong></a> noyau <p>Lorsque le serveur trouve un fichier .htaccess (comme spécifié par <a href="#accessfilename">AccessFileName</a>) il doit savoir quelles directives declarées dans ce fichier peuvent outrepasser les droits fixés par des directives précédentes.</p> <p>Si la directive est définie à <code>None</code>, les fichier .htaccess sont ignorés. Dans ce cas, le serveur n'essaie même pas de lire les fichiers .htaccess.</p> <p>Si la directive est définie à <code>All</code> toutes les directives possibles dans le <a href="directive-dict.html#Context">contexte</a> .htacces sont autorisées dans les fichiers .htaccess.</p> <p>Les <em>types de directives</em> peuvent être parmi ces groupes de directives :</p> <dl> <dt>AuthConfig</dt> <dd> <!--%plaintext <?INDEX {\tt AuthConfig} override> --> Autorise l'usage de la directive Authorization (<a href="mod_auth_dbm.html#authdbmgroupfile">AuthDBMGroupFile</a>, <a href="mod_auth_dbm.html#authdbmuserfile">AuthDBMUserFile</a>, <a href="mod_auth.html#authgroupfile">AuthGroupFile</a>, <a href="#authname">AuthName</a>, <a href="#authtype">AuthType</a>, <a href="mod_auth.html#authuserfile">AuthUserFile</a>, <a href="#require">Require</a>, etc.).</dd> <dt>FileInfo</dt> <dd><!--%plaintext <?INDEX {\tt FileInfo} override> --> Autorise l'usage de directives contrôlant l'accès aux types de documents (<a href="mod_mime.html#addencoding">AddEncoding</a>, <a href="mod_mime.html#addlanguage">AddLanguage</a>, <a href="mod_mime.html#addtype">AddType</a>, <a href="#defaulttype">DefaultType</a>, <a href="#errordocument">ErrorDocument</a>, <a href="mod_negotiation.html#languagepriority">LanguagePriority</a>, etc.).</dd> <dt>Indexes</dt> <dd><!--%plaintext <?INDEX {\tt Indexes} override> --> Autorise l'usage de directives contrôlant l'indexation des répertoires (<a href="mod_autoindex.html#adddescription">AddDescription</a>, <a href="mod_autoindex.html#addicon">AddIcon</a>, <a href="mod_autoindex.html#addiconbyencoding">AddIconByEncoding</a>, <a href="mod_autoindex.html#addiconbytype">AddIconByType</a>, <a href="mod_autoindex.html#defaulticon">DefaultIcon</a>, <a href="mod_dir.html#directoryindex">DirectoryIndex</a>, <a href="mod_autoindex.html#fancyindexing">FancyIndexing</a>, <a href="mod_autoindex.html#headername">HeaderName</a>, <a href="mod_autoindex.html#indexignore">IndexIgnore</a>, <a href="mod_autoindex.html#indexoptions">IndexOptions</a>, <a href="mod_autoindex.html#readmename">ReadmeName</a>, etc.).</dd> <dt>Limit</dt> <dd><!--%plaintext <?INDEX {\tt Limit} override> --> Autorise l'usage de directives contrôlant les accès de certains hôtes (allow, deny et order).</dd> <dt>Options</dt> <dd><!--%plaintext <?INDEX {\tt Options} override> --> Autorise l'usage de directives contrôlant certaines fonctionnalités spécifiques des répertoires (<a href="#options">Options</a> et <a href="mod_include.html#xbithack">XBitHack</a>).</dd> </dl> <p><strong>Voir également :</strong> <a href="#accessfilename">AccessFileName</a></p> <hr /> <h2><a id="authname" name="authname">Directive AuthName</a></h2> <!--%plaintext <?INDEX {\tt AuthName} directive> --> <a href="directive-dict.html#Syntax" rel="Help"><strong>Syntaxe :</strong></a> AuthName <em>domaine-autorisé</em><br /> <a href="directive-dict.html#Context" rel="Help"><strong>Contexte :</strong></a> répertoire, .htaccess<br /> <a href="directive-dict.html#Override" rel="Help"><strong>Surcharge :</strong></a> AuthConfig<br /> <a href="directive-dict.html#Status" rel="Help"><strong>Statut :</strong></a> noyau <p>Cette directive indique le nom du schéma d'autorisation pour un répertoire. Ce schéma sera donné au client de sorte que l'utilisateur sache quel nom et quel mot de passe envoyer. <samp>AuthName</samp> prend un seul argument. Si le schéma d'autorisation contient des espaces, il doit être entouré de guillemets. Pour fonctionner correctement, elle devra être accompagnée des directives <a href="#authtype">AuthType</a> et <a href="#require">require</a>, et de directives telles que <a href="mod_auth.html#authuserfile">AuthUserFile</a> et <a href="mod_auth.html#authgroupfile">AuthGroupFile</a>.</p> <hr /> <h2><a id="authtype" name="authtype">Directive AuthType</a></h2> <!--%plaintext <?INDEX {\tt AuthType} directive> --> <a href="directive-dict.html#Syntax" rel="Help"><strong>Syntaxe :</strong></a> AuthType <em>type</em><br /> <a href="directive-dict.html#Context" rel="Help"><strong>Contexte :</strong></a> répertoire, .htaccess<br /> <a href="directive-dict.html#Override" rel="Help"><strong>Surcharge :</strong></a> AuthConfig<br /> <a href="directive-dict.html#Status" rel="Help"><strong>Statut :</strong></a> noyau <p>Cette directive selectionne le type d'authentification pour un répertoire. Seul les types <code>Basic</code> et <code>Digest</code> sont actuellement implémentés. <!--%plaintext <?INDEX {\tt Basic} authentication scheme> --> Pour fonctionner correctement, elle devra être accompagnée des directives <a href="#authname">AuthName</a> et <a href="#require">require</a>, et de directives telles que <a href="mod_auth.html#authuserfile">AuthUserFile</a> et <a href="mod_auth.html#authgroupfile">AuthGroupFile</a>.</p> <hr /> <h2><a id="bindaddress" name="bindaddress">Directive BindAddress</a></h2> <!--%plaintext <?INDEX {\tt BindAddress} directive> --> <a href="directive-dict.html#Syntax" rel="Help"><strong>Syntaxe :</strong></a> BindAddress *|<em>addresse IP</em>|<em>nom de domaine</em><br /> <a href="directive-dict.html#Default" rel="Help"><strong>Défaut :</strong></a> <code>BindAddress *</code><br /> <a href="directive-dict.html#Context" rel="Help"><strong>Contexte :</strong></a> configuration serveur<br /> <a href="directive-dict.html#Status" rel="Help"><strong>Statut :</strong></a> noyau <p>Un serveur http sous Unix® peut soit écouter toutes les adresses IP de la machine sur lequel il est exécuté, ou uniquement une de ces adresses. Si l'argument de cette directive est *, le serveur traitera les connections sur toutes les adresses IP. Sinon, le serveur peut écouter à partir d'une <em>adresse IP</em> spécifique ou d'un <em>nom de domaine</em> Internet.</p> <p>Une et une seule directive <tt>BindAddress</tt> peut être utilisée. Pour contrôler plus finement quels ports et adresses Apache écoute, utilisez la directive <a href="#listen">Listen</a> au lieu de <tt>BindAddress</tt>.</p> <p><tt>BindAddress</tt> peut être utilisée comme alternative à l'implantation d'<a href="../vhosts/">hôtes virtuels</a> utilisant des serveurs multiples indépendants, soit au lieu d'utiliser les sections <a href="#virtualhost"><VirtualHost></a>.</p> <p><strong>Voir aussi:</strong> <a href="../dns-caveats.html">Apache et DNS</a><br /> <strong>Voir aussi:</strong> <a href="../bind.html">Configurer les ports et adresses utilisés par Apache</a></p> <hr /> <h2><a id="bs2000account" name="bs2000account">BS2000Account directive</a></h2> <!--%plaintext <?INDEX {\tt BS2000Account} directive> --> <a href="directive-dict.html#Syntax" rel="Help"><strong>Syntaxe :</strong></a> BS2000Account <em>account</em><br /> <a href="directive-dict.html#Default" rel="Help"><strong>Défaut :</strong></a> <em>none</em><br /> <a href="directive-dict.html#Context" rel="Help"><strong>Contexte :</strong></a> configuration serveur<br /> <a href="directive-dict.html#Status" rel="Help"><strong>Statut :</strong></a> noyau<br /> <a href="directive-dict.html#Compatibility" rel="Help"><strong>Compatibilité :</strong></a> BS2000Account n'est valable que pour les machines BS2000, à partir de la version 1.3 d'Apache. <p>La directive <code>BS2000Account</code> n'est disponible que pour les machines BS2000. Elle doit être employée pour définir le numéro de compte pour l'utilisateur non privilégié (qui est défini par la directive <a href="#user">User</a> ). Ceci est requis par le sous système POSIX du BS2000 afin de changer l'environnement d'exécution sosu jacent du BS200 en effectuant une sous connexion, et éviter ainsi que des scripts CGI puissent accéder à des ressources accessible à l'utilisateur privilégié utilisé pour lancer le serveur,
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-